BOARDMAN — Independent bakery cooperative, The Long Co., awarded Schwebel Baking Co. with its Best Premium Bun Gold Cup Annual Trophy for the second year in a row. More than 70 wholesale bakeries sent samples for scoring. Samples were rated on qualities such as crust thickness and color, interior grain and uniformity of cell structure, flavor, aroma and general eating qualities.

BOARDMAN — The Holiday Inn - Boardman received two awards from the Intercontinental Hotel Group at its Annual Leaders & Investors Conference. The hotel received a 2007 Quality Excellence Award, given to hotels achieving distinction in all aspects of their operations. The hotel also received a Renovation Award and was one of only 50 hotels in the system to be honored in that area. Holiday Inn - Boardman’s renovations included TJ’s Restaurant & Lounge, exercise room, business center, hotel lobby and public restrooms. New bedding and a conversion from wired to wireless are also recent developments at the hotel.

AUSTINTOWN — Carney-McNicholas, an agent of United Van Lines, has been honored by United for exceptional professional achievement. Carney-McNicholas Inc. received the President’s Club Award for having $3 million in sales and the Customer Choice Award for providing exceptional service.

NEW CASTLE, PA. — Stevens Masonry Construction of New Castle is a 2007 winner of the coveted Golden Trowel award for its work on the $50 million New Castle High School project. Stevens won Golden Trowel best-in-category of educational facilities for interior work. The Golden Trowel awards are sponsored by the International Masonry Institute.

BOARDMAN — In honor of their career achievements, Kathy Cottrill and Betty McKendry, both of Boardman, have earned the use of the executive Mary Kay Pink Cadillac, the most coveted incentive awarded by the company. About 6,500 Mary Kay career cars are on the road nationwide with more than 1,800 of those being pink Cadillacs. Independent sales directors earn the use of Mary Kay career cars through outstanding sales achievements by themselves and their units.
